硬件辅助虚拟化技术就是解决虚拟化漏洞的软件方案之一,笼统的讲,就是在虚拟机执行敏感指令的时候通过超调用主动陷入Hypervisor. Intel VT-x引入了VMX操作模式,包括根模式和非根模式,Hypervisor运行在根模式而虚拟机运行在非根模式. 非根模式中所有的敏感指令都会触发VM-Exit而陷入Hypervisor,让所有敏感指令都会触发异常....
虚拟化技术, 是页表扩充技术Extended Page Table (EPT) 的缩写, 是VT-x技术的一部分。 内存虚拟化的主要任务是实现地址空间的虚拟化,内存虚拟化是通过两次地址转换来支持地址空间的虚拟化,即客户机虚拟地址GVA->客户机器物理地址GPA->宿主机物理地址HPA的转换。传统的IA-32只支持一次地址转换。而内存虚拟化要求2次...
硬件辅助的虚拟化技术,又称为芯片辅助(Chip-Assisted)的虚拟化技术,最初来自于 Intel CPU 实现的 VT(Virtualization Technology)技术,现在已经逐渐发展为以下虚拟化技术扩展分支: Intel VT-x(Intel Virtualization Technology for x86):使得 VMM(虚拟机监视器)能够在 Intel x86 CPU 上直接运行,而不需要通过 “二进制...
首先,我们需要了解虚拟化的概念。虚拟化,无论是Intel的VT-x/EPT还是AMD的V/RVI,其目的都是让单核CPU呈现出多核的效果。它允许一个平台同时运行多个操作系统,并且每个应用程序都在独立的空间内运行,互不干扰。这样,虚拟机能够获得本机上的硬件虚拟化特性,从而提升性能。接下来,我们可以从系统层面进行设置。...
创建Linux虚拟机,出现“intel vt -x 处于禁用状态打不开 这个时候我们就需要开启虚拟化。 问题来了,怎么开启虚拟化?: 1、开启虚拟化之前,确保你的物理机电脑是支持虚拟化的。64位系统,32系统的请绕路! 不支持的,不用问了,问就是买新电脑。 新电脑买个i5以上的,有的i3可能不支持虚拟化,注意,是给你的物理...
英特尔虚拟化技术VT-x技术的全称是:英特尔的硬件辅助虚拟化技术(Vanderpool Technology是一种设计更简单、实施更高效和可靠的方法,是世界上首个X86平台的硬件辅助虚拟化解决方案。它对如何在不同的情形下分配给Guest OS (虚拟机上的操作系统) 想要的Ring 特权级别做了很好的改进。在 IT 环境中实现更高...
1. 开启BIOS中的虚拟化技术:a. 重启电脑并进入BIOS设置界面(通常按下F2、Del键或者其他键即可进入)。b. 找到虚拟化技术相关的选项,如Intel VT-x或AMD-V,并将其启用。c. 保存设置并退出BIOS。2. 在操作系统中启用虚拟化技术:a. 如果已经开启了BIOS中的虚拟化技术,但仍然显示禁用或未开启VT...
启用Intel VT-x的最直接方法是进入计算机的BIOS设置并手动启用它。1. 重启计算机:在大多数情况下,要进入BIOS设置,首先需要重启计算机。确保计算机完全关闭,然后再次启动。2. 进入BIOS设置:在计算机重启时,通常会有提示按某个键(如F2、F10、Delete等)进入BIOS设置。不同的计算机品牌可能有不同的按键...
VT-x 是 Intel CPU 的硬件虚拟化技术,提供内存以及虚拟机的硬件隔离,这也是平常我们想在 intel 平台上做虚拟化最基本需要支持的技术。 VT-x不仅需要处理器的支持,也需要主板、BOIS的支持 VT-c英文全程为 Virtualization Technology for Connectivity VT-c 主要是针对提高网络 I/O 提供的虚拟化技术,它可以在一个...
Intel VT技术是处理器层面的重要特性,它主要由VTx、VTd和VTc三部分技术组成。VTx作为处理器技术的核心,主要负责内存以及虚拟机的硬件隔离,通过页表管理和地址空间保护等技术实现。VTd则侧重于芯片组层面,提供针对虚拟机的特殊应用支持,例如它能够使某些特定的虚拟机应用能够越过处理器I/O管理程序,直接...